New species of the genus Hyleoglomeris from Korea (Diplopoda: Glomerida: Glomeridae)

Abstract

Five new species of the millipede genus Hyleoglomeris Verhoeff, 1910 (Glomeridae) are described from South Korea: Hyleoglomeris unicolorata sp. n., H. buana sp. n., H. obscura sp. n., H. confragosa sp. n. and H. alutacea sp. n. Several earlier misidentifications are corrected. All currently known Hyleoglomeris species from Korea are keyed, including new species.
